[0001] This utility model relates to the field of loudspeaker technology, specifically to a loudspeaker using a fixed combination of a frame, a piezoelectric ceramic sheet, and a diaphragm. Background Technology
[0002] A loudspeaker is a transducer that converts electrical signals into sound signals. Audio electrical energy vibrates its cone or diaphragm through electromagnetic, piezoelectric, or electrostatic effects, causing it to resonate with the surrounding air and produce sound.
[0003] Existing loudspeakers typically use a magnetic circuit consisting of a magnet, a magnetic plate, and a T-iron (U-iron), which is then combined with a voice coil, a spider (positioning support), and a diaphragm to form the vibrating part. When in use, an AC signal is applied to both ends of the voice coil, and the voice coil vibrates up and down in the magnetic field due to the change of magnetic lines of force, which drives the diaphragm to vibrate and produce sound. The overall structure is relatively complicated and the yield rate is not high.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this invention is to provide a loudspeaker that uses a frame, a piezoelectric ceramic sheet and a fixed combination of a diaphragm to solve the problems mentioned in the background art.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, the present invention provides the following technical solution: a loudspeaker using a frame, a piezoelectric ceramic sheet and a diaphragm fixedly combined, comprising a frame and a piezoelectric ceramic sheet, wherein a first mounting groove is provided at the bottom of the frame and a piezoelectric ceramic sheet is placed inside the first mounting groove, and a second mounting groove is provided at the top of the frame and a diaphragm is bonded inside the second mounting groove, and the diaphragm is fixedly connected to the piezoelectric ceramic sheet.

[0013] This utility model provides a loudspeaker using a combination of a frame, a piezoelectric ceramic sheet, and a diaphragm, which has the following advantages:
[0014] 1. This utility model, through the setting of piezoelectric ceramic sheet, allows the piezoelectric ceramic sheet to vibrate by applying an AC signal during use, thereby driving the diaphragm to vibrate and produce sound. Compared with the existing method of using a magnet, magnetic plate, T-iron to form a magnetic circuit, and then combining a voice coil, spider, and diaphragm to form a vibrating part to produce sound, this application has a simple overall structure and greatly improves the yield rate in the loudspeaker production process.
[0015] 2. By setting up a support frame, this utility model allows the circuit board of the piezoelectric ceramic sheet to be installed simply by placing it inside the support frame. At this time, the clamping plate will deform under pressure to automatically avoid it, while the stop block will limit the top of the circuit board. After the clamping plate resets, it can limit the bottom of the circuit board, thus facilitating the assembly between the circuit board and the frame. At the same time, the avoidance groove is used to avoid the connecting wires between the circuit board and the piezoelectric ceramic sheet, thereby improving the convenience of assembly. [0021] like Figure 1 and Figure 2As shown, a loudspeaker using a fixed combination of a frame, a piezoelectric ceramic plate, and a diaphragm includes a frame 1 and a piezoelectric ceramic plate 3. The bottom of the frame 1 has a first mounting groove 2, and the piezoelectric ceramic plate 3 is placed inside the first mounting groove 2. The top of the frame 1 has a second mounting groove 4, and the diaphragm 5 is bonded inside the second mounting groove 4 and fixedly connected to the piezoelectric ceramic plate 3. The diameter of the frame 1 is 79.6 mm and the height of the frame 1 is 21.2 mm. During use, by applying an AC signal to the piezoelectric ceramic plate 3, the piezoelectric ceramic plate 3 vibrates, causing the diaphragm 5 to vibrate and produce sound. The overall structure is simple and greatly improves the yield rate in the production process.
[0022] like Figure 1 and Figure 3 As shown, the bottom of the basin holder 1 has a clearance groove 6, and a support frame 7 is provided in the middle of one side of the basin holder 1. The clearance groove 6 is used to avoid the connecting wires between the circuit board and the piezoelectric ceramic sheet 3. The support frame 7 limits the movement of the circuit board around its perimeter. A stop block 8 is fixed inside the support frame 7, and a retaining plate 9 is provided at the bottom of the support frame 7. The stop block 8 limits the movement of the top of the circuit board. The retaining plate 9 is J-shaped, and the bottom surface of the retaining plate 9 is inclined. When the circuit board is installed, the retaining plate 9 will deform under pressure to automatically avoid the circuit board. After the card plate 9 is reset, it can limit the bottom of the circuit board. The two sides of the basin frame 1 are equipped with mounting plates 10, and the two ends of the mounting plates 10 are provided with mounting holes 11. The mounting plates 10 are fixed by the mounting holes 11. The bottom of the mounting plate 10 is fixed with a side frame 12, and a reinforcing rib 13 is symmetrically arranged on one side of the side frame 12. The reinforcing rib 13 is fixedly connected to the mounting plate 10 and also fixedly connected to the basin frame 1. The reinforcing rib 13 can improve the connection strength between the mounting plate 10 and the basin frame 1.

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3In the structure shown, during assembly, the piezoelectric ceramic sheet 3 and the diaphragm 5 are first bonded to the inside of the first mounting groove 2 and the second mounting groove 4, respectively. Then, the circuit board of the piezoelectric ceramic sheet 3 is placed inside the support frame 7. At this time, the clamping plate 9 will deform under pressure to automatically avoid the pressure. After that, the support frame 7 will limit the horizontal direction of the circuit board, and the stop block 8 will limit the top of the circuit board. After the clamping plate 9 is reset, it can limit the bottom of the circuit board, thus facilitating the installation of the circuit board. At the same time, the avoidance groove 6 is used to avoid the connecting wires between the circuit board and the piezoelectric ceramic sheet 3. Then, the side bracket 12 is inserted into the hole on the device housing, and the mounting plate 10 is fixed with bolts and mounting holes 11, thus completing the speaker installation operation. The reinforcing rib 13 can improve the connection strength between the mounting plate 10 and the frame 1. Finally, during use, by applying an AC signal to the piezoelectric ceramic sheet 3, the piezoelectric ceramic sheet 3 vibrates, causing the diaphragm 5 to vibrate and produce sound.
